How does this calculator work?
1 atm = 760 Torr (exact). To convert Torr to atm divide by 760; to convert atm to Torr multiply by 760. The calculator also shows the equivalent in Pa, kPa, bar and psi, with a number-line view of the pressure on an atmospheric scale.

How this is calculated
The Torr was originally defined to equal one millimetre of mercury (mmHg) under standard gravity — the pressure that supports a 1 mm column of mercury at 0 °C and g = 9.80665 m/s². Since 1954 the Torr has been defined precisely as 1/760 of a standard atmosphere, where 1 atm = 101 325 Pa exactly. This means 1 Torr = 101 325/760 Pa ≈ 133.322 Pa. In practice, 1 Torr and 1 mmHg differ by less than 0.00016%, so they are interchangeable in almost all laboratory contexts.
The standard atmosphere (atm) is an exact defined constant equal to 101 325 Pa. It represents the average air pressure at sea level and is the reference point for many chemical and physical tables. A pressure of 760 Torr is therefore exactly 1 atm.
This converter also outputs kilopascals (divide Pa by 1000), bar (divide Pa by 100 000), and psi (divide Pa by 6894.757). All conversions are mathematically exact or rounded only at display time.

1 atm = 101 325 Pa exactly — an international constant that approximates sea-level air pressure. It is used as a reference in gas laws, thermodynamic tables, and as a unit for moderate pressures in chemistry.
Torr is common in vacuum technology (rough to high vacuum), blood pressure measurement (traditionally in mmHg), gas chromatography, and astronomy. Pa and bar dominate in SI-based engineering. Meteorologists prefer hPa (= mbar).
